The problem is that many people do not understand the words and terms being used. Paste, QSI, Buffer, etc. It is ALL foreign to many new users. No matter how many instructions you write or how many times you suggest to read the instructions, many people do not understand the words. Some people will learn from watching a video. Maybe a link to a video can be added to that pop-up box? I don't know. Just spit-balling. I have no idea what the answer is.
